About Taipei
Taipei City is the capital of Taiwan and a city that has been developing fast. Taipei has a very welcoming feel, and the city embraces its tourists with open arms. The city will instantly make you fall in love with it. The locals here are quite helpful and very friendly. The city has a lot of historical monuments, museums, gardens and age-old temples that are worth visiting. It might not be exactly adventurous, but it is definitely worth visiting. You get to learn a lot about the lifestyle and culture that the locals here lead. The city has also quite adapted to the party scenes and makes sure you get a party if you are looking for one. Shilin Night Market and Ximending are some of the popular places in the city to shop. Taipei also boasts of housing the world's eighth tallest building which is about 508 metres tall called Taipei 101. Needless to say, the view from up there is simply breathtaking and one that you are definitely not going to forget. The city also has lush greenery and hot springs so tourists can get rid of all their stress and just relax.
Best Time to Visit Taipei City
Taipei experiences the spring season from March to May which is also the peak tourist season. You can go for a hike to the Elephant Mountain and be amazed at how beautiful the trails look, thanks to spring. The temperature ranges from 20 to 25 degree Celsius, and it even rains a little bit during spring. If you vacation clashes with The Tomb Sweeping Day, which is a public holiday celebrated in April, you will find most streets deserted at this time. Since this is peak travel season, make sure you book your hotel in Taipei several weeks in advance because availability might become an issue at the last moment. Not to mention, the hotel prices also see a surge during this season, so you will end up paying more money on accommodation that you otherwise might. You will also have to book your flight tickets to Taipei in advance.
September to November is autumn season in Taipei, and there are fewer tourists in the city. If you don't like crowds, this is the right time for you to head to Taipei. The temperature ranges from 23 to 30 degree Celsius and is quite comfortable. Hotel and flight prices also drop considerably during this time. You might get a good deal on a flight ticket to Taipei in autumn. You can take a stroll by the lakes or head to the beach, and you can enjoy exploring the city without being hassled by tourists. The locals also prefer and love this season better than the rest. While the days are warm and sunny, the nights are comparatively cool. The Moon Festival and Double Ten Day are some of the popular events that are celebrated during this time.
The city experiences summer from June to August, and the temperature reaches a maximum of 30 degree Celsius. This is a low tourist season since there is also a threat of typhoons hitting the city in summer. Though you might be able to get cheap flight tickets to Taipei and cheaper accommodations, this is not the best time to plan your vacation to Taipei. However, if you are in the city during early summer, you might be able to catch the Dragon Boat Festival. December to February is the winter season and the temperature drops to a minimum of 10 degree Celsius. It is not too cold, and a lot of tourists actually love planning a winter trip to Taipei.
Places to Visit in Taipei City
Taipei 101 is an important landmark in Taipei and one you must definitely not miss. It is the eighth tallest building in the world and is an architectural marvel. National Palace Museum is yet another major tourist spot that houses artworks and artefacts from more than 10,000 years ago. Ximending is a popular neighbourhood in Taipei and quite the party destination, too. You can also head to Shilin Night Market for some delicious street food and a satisfying shopping spree. Though you will also find a lot of fancy restaurants at the market, travellers recommend that you give the local street food stalls a shot. The Longshan Temple is one of the oldest temples in Taiwan and is mainly popular because of its markets. Xinbeitou Hot Springs is the best getaway from the hustle and bustle of the city. You can also head to the National Taiwan Museum, which is one of the oldest museums in all of Taiwan. If you are an animal lover, you have got to visit the Taipei Zoo. It is a very popular tourist attraction for families with kids.
If you are a history buff, you are going to love a visit to the National History Museum. It was built in 1955 and showcased a lot of important collections that depict Taiwan's history. Dadaocheng Wharf has become a tourist attraction today along the Tamsui River. It used to be a major trade location before it transformed.

Foods and Restaurants in Taipei
Taipei is one city where you will find all sorts of cuisine. It is a modern city and caters to all kinds of taste buds. Though there are quite a few dishes here that are inspired by Chinese cuisine, the locals have managed to make Taiwanese food stand out. Gua bao is a popular pork belly dish that is quite popular in Taiwan; so is the oyster omelette. Taipei also has a lot of Indian restaurants like Mayur Indian Kitchen, Saffron Fine Indian Restaurant, Balle Balle Indian Restaurant and Ali Baba's Indian Kitchen. However, it is not very easy to find vegetarian food in the city. Mik-4ever Indian Restaurant is a popular restaurant that has quite a few options for vegetarian and vegan dishes. Hotpot and beef noodle soup are some of the other popularly ordered foods at restaurants here. The local street food at the night markets here are delightful, and you must try it. Ay-Chung Flour Rice Noodles is a very popular restaurant that you must try. The mee sua with braised pork intestine is a highly recommended dish at the restaurant. Fuhang Soy Milk is yet another popular restaurant in the city that serves traditional Taiwanese breakfast. You can also head to the Tao-Yuan Street Beef Noodle Shop for more variety in Taiwanese cuisine.

About Nice
Located on the coast of Baie des Anges and the capital of the Alpes-Maritimes department on the French Riviera is the alluring city of Nice. The jewel of French Riviera, Nice boasts not just a sparkling shoreline but also historical monuments and artistic architecture.
Best time to visit Nice
For Nice, it is important that you visit the lovely coastal city in a season where the temperatures are balanced, and the hotel rooms are cheap. You need to make sure to capitalise on the hotel room rate that usually happens between March and April. The Mediterranean vibe of the city is prevalent all-round the year. Still, it is from mid-March to April and September to October when the accommodations are also pocket-friendly. The months from May to August see a multitude of crowds who wish to soak in the Mediterranean bliss and hot temperatures. It is also the time when the hotel prices surge to an exorbitant level. You will need to fill your pockets with some heavy euros to make it through summer in Nice. Perks of the season are some of the beautiful festivals that take place including, Nice International Film Festival, Nice Jazz Festival, Crossover Festival and Festival du Livre. It is recommended that you make prior bookings of hotels and flights to Nice if you're rooting for summer. If you're opting for September and October, you don't have to worry much about the excess crowd as well as accommodation prices.
Tourists can visit some of the famous attractions but expect a little crowd. However, it won't be as crowded as how the summers are in Nice. In fact, you will be able to soak in the Mediterranean sun as well as enjoy sightseeing. There are no major festivals that take place during this time of the year, so you'll probably not be able to indulge in the exciting ambience of it. But for solitude and happy vibes, the place remains open. Mid-March to April are also good months to hang out in Nice. The French Riviera bustles with fewer crowds but beautiful weather. The spring season is actually quite pleasant in Nice as the temperature ranges from 14 degree Celsius to 16 degree Celsius. The weather remains calm, but the warm sun adds to the experience. Plus, there is an interesting event that the city hosts, International Dog Show. If you are someone who loves canines, you should definitely check this event out. Plus, during spring, the hotel bookings in Nice continue to remain low-priced, giving way to a comfortable stay, maybe even facing the sea.
Places to visit in Nice
Place Masséna is the first place you can start. It is the city's main square and has a bunch of interesting things to do around the vicinity. The next could be a visit to the Promenade des Anglais (English Walk). The pebbly shore with a beachfront is a sight for the sore eyes. Castle Hill (Colline du Chateau) with its scenic location is highly recommended. You shouldn't miss Nice Beaches because they are eccentric and too gorgeous. If you are an art patron, then you should pay a visit to the Musée d'Art Moderne et d'Art Contemporain, popularly known as Museum of Modern & Contemporary Art. To make things a little religious, you can also check out St. Nicholas Russian Orthodox Cathedral. Garden of the Cimiez Monastery is another lovely locale that would marvel you. It is basically an orchard and vegetable garden that was used by monks in the old times. To make your experience more luxe, you can visit Palais Lascaris, which once belonged to the first noble families of the city.

Food and Restaurants in Nice
The cuisine of Nice slightly tweaks the traditional French cuisine and adds a bit of Mediterranean flavour to it. Hence, while you will find fresh cheese, vegetables and meat, they'll come with a refreshing twist of flavours inspired by the Mediterranean lifestyle. The Niçoise cuisine has seafood as their staple food. It is not surprising considering how the city is located on the coast, making fish and seafood easy to acquire. Expect tuna and anchovies tossed with fresh baby tomatoes, green leafy vegetables and green beans with a light olive oil dressing to complete the traditional Niçois salad. This is a famous local dish that you will get to taste and you must. There are Italian-inspired pissaladieres too which include anchovies and caramelised onions as the topping to small-sized pizzas. To make the most of the Niçoise cuisine, you should visit Vieux-Nice (Old Town) as well as Port District. These two places have a slew of restaurants and food establishments that glorify the Niçoise cuisine. One of the popular places to visit would be the Restaurant Le Frog. The place specialises in French and classic Mediterranean meals.
You should know that the French cuisine has a snail appetiser, prominently known as escargot. While you do have the option to try it out here at Nice, it can be clubbed with a lovely entree and drinks. For a less-expensive but wholesome food experience in Nice, you can visit some of the food establishments close to Cathédrale Sainte-Réparate in Vieux-Nice. Les Gaiçons is a famous establishment known for its gourmet French food. Many more restaurants are also available close to the Promenade des Anglais (Walk of the English). Places such as La Route Du Miam, Les Amourex, Cumin et Cannelle, Eden Garden, Polly and Cie, to name a few. These places will certainly upscale your French rendezvous with lip-smacking food. Expecting international or rather global cuisine in Nice is being very hopeful. The city celebrates French and Niçois cuisine and doesn't entertain any other global kitchen. In fact, at the most, you can find African and contemporary cuisine, but that is the extent.
